The sizes are indeed diferent. The character combat sprites are 64x64. The large weapons take 3 times that space 192x192.
The weapon is arranged in the center block, and the character image is overlaid in the center block also.
I hope this image explains it better
The purple region is the weapon sprite and the blue region the character sprite.
Thanks for the kind words.